As I said, you > > have the src and dst already in registers and you know they are aligned, > > so just put the size of the frame in a register (divided by 4), do an > > mtctr and do a little load_update/store_update loop to do the copy, all > > in the asm. > > Is the following Okay? Well, why did you bother with the flushes ? One of the main reason I wasn't too happy with hijacking copy_and_flush is that ... you really don't need to bother about flushing the cache :-) The flush in that routine is about copying kernel code around and making sure the I/D caches stay in sync.
